Oscillators

Oscillators are electronic components that produce a continuous, repetitive electrical signal. An oscillator is the core of many electronic systems, such as clocks, radios, TVs, and computers. At the heart of almost every electrical system is some type of oscillator, such as oscillators for frequency control, amplification, modulation, and tuning.

The most basic type of oscillator is the simple sinusoidal oscillator. This type of oscillator is an electrical circuit that creates a continuous alternating current (AC). In the simplest form, an oscillator consists of an amplifier and a feedback element, such as a resistor, capacitor, or inductor. When the amplifier is turned on, the feedback element ensures that an oscillating signal is generated. This signal is an alternating waveform, usually sinusoidal.
